Centenary Soccer Programs Receive Prestigious Academic Honors

Nine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ference men's and women's soccer programs have been named to the 2018-2019 team and Centenary is one of just three in the SCAC to receive the honors for both men's and women's programs, with Southwestern and Trinity being the other two. Colorado College and Dallas were recognized on the men's side and Texas Lutheran on the women's.

Centenary earned this honor for the second year in a row.A total of 992 college teams (345 men, 647 women) earned the Team Academic Award, including 257 schools who had both their men's and women's programs among the recipients.

United Soccer Coaches annually celebrates the academic achievements of high school and college soccer teams whose student-athletes collectively demonstrate a commitment to excellence in their studies over the course of a full academic year.
